Behrend Opens 2005-06 Season With 68-57 Win Over Westminster

The Penn State Behrend women’s basketball team opened the 2005-06 season at home this weekend with an eleven point win over the Westminster Titans (0-1) in their annual tip-off tournament at Behrend’s Junker Center. 

The Behrend Lions jumped out to a 10-1 lead to start the contest after a lay-up by sophomore Julia Andrus (Corry/Corry) at the 11:52 mark. Junior sensation Brittany Mays (Knox/Keystone) knocked down a ten-foot jumper with one second in the half to send the blue and white to the break with a 27-16 lead. In the second half the Titans could not get closer than ten.

Rachel Slomski (Erie/McDowell) paced the offense with 16 points on 6 x 7 from the floor. She also worked for six rebounds in twenty-two minutes of action. Sophomore Jessica Serafin (Boalsburg/State College) hit for a career high 16 points on 4-of-9 from long distance. Mays has another steady game with 12 points, six rebounds, six steals and three assists.

The Behrend Lions will play Case Western (1-0) on Saturday, November 19, at 3:00 p.m. in the Penn State Behrend Tip-Off Tournament Championship game. CWR advances via a 67-50 win over Mt. Union. CWR was led by Amber Hammell who hit for a game-high 21 points. The consolation game features Mt. Union against Westminster at 1:00 p.m. in the Junker Center. 

Following this weekend's tip-off tournament, coach Roz Fornari’s team will hit the road for a pair of AMCC games at Pitt-Greensburg on December 2, and then travel to Frostburg State on December 3.
